HamburgerMenu
hirist

Job Description

Role : Senior DevOps Engineer.

Location : Bangalore.

Work Mode : Onsite 5D (No Remote/ Hybrid).

Duration : Full-Time.

Timings : 1-10 PM.

Experience : 4+ yrs.

Skills to crack : Teamcity; Docker; ECS; AWS; Terraform; CloudWatch.

Role Summary :



We are seeking a DevOps Engineer to support, optimize, and scale infrastructure and deployment workflows for containerized applications running in AWS.

This role focuses on the build, release, monitoring, and automation of Docker-based systems in a cloud-native environment.

You will work closely with developers and architects to ensure reliable, secure, and high-performing deployments in production and development environments.

Core Tech Stack :



Containers & Orchestration : Docker, ECS, EKS.

Cloud Platform : AWS (EC2, S3, IAM, Lambda, VPC, CloudFormation, Terraform).

CI/CD & Automation : TeamCity, GitHub Actions, AWS CodePipeline, AWS CodeBuild, Jenkins.

Monitoring & Logging : CloudWatch, ELK, Prometheus, Grafana.

Languages & Tools : JavaScript, Bash, Python, Go.

Qualifications :


- 4+ years of experience in DevOps, SRE, or cloud infrastructure engineering.


- Strong hands-on experience with Docker and containerized application deployment.

- Proven knowledge of AWS core services, infrastructure design, and best practices.



- Experience building and managing CI/CD pipelines using TeamCity, GitHub Actions, and AWS CodePipeline.


- Proficiency with infrastructure-as-code tools : Terraform and CloudFormation.


- Strong understanding of networking, security, and high-availability patterns in AWS.


- Ability to troubleshoot complex infrastructure and deployment issues quickly and effectively.

Key Responsibilities :


Containerization & Orchestration :



- Build and maintain Docker images and containers for application services.


- Manage container lifecycle in AWS-hosted environments (ECS, EKS).

Cloud Infrastructure :


- Design, provision, and manage AWS infrastructure using infrastructure-as-code tools (Terraform, CloudFormation).


- Ensure scalability, resilience, and cost-efficiency of cloud deployments.

CI/CD Pipelines :


- Develop and manage continuous integration and deployment pipelines.


- Automate build, test, and release processes using TeamCity, GitHub Actions, and AWS CodePipeline.

Monitoring & Logging :


- Implement and maintain observability tools such as CloudWatch, Prometheus, and ELK.


- Create dashboards and alerts to ensure proactive system health management.

Security & Compliance :


- Apply security best practices in container and cloud environments (IAM, VPCs, encryption, scanning).


- Ensure compliance with internal security and change management policies.

Collaboration & Support :


- Support engineering teams with infrastructure needs, deployment issues, and environment configuration.


- Participate in incident response and postmortems to ensure continuous improvement.

Bonus Experience :


- Working knowledge of Redpanda.


- Exposure to Starburst.


- Experience supporting JavaScript-based applications or build systems in a DevOps context.


info-icon

Did you find something suspicious?